WooCommerce 電商網站開發全攻略:從零到上線的完整指南

2 分钟阅读
2026-03-14
2026-06-04
2,086
通过下方链接进行购物时,您无需支付额外费用,我就能获得佣金。.

開發準備與核心安裝

建設一個穩定可靠的WooCommerce電商網站始於精心準備。首要任務是選擇一個性能優異、支援最新PHP版本的主機環境,並確保已備好域名。隨後,需要在WordPress後臺完成一次標準的WordPress安裝。

安裝的核心步驟在於整合WooCommerce外掛本身。透過WordPress儀表盤進入“外掛” -> “安裝外掛”,搜尋“WooCommerce”並點選“立即安裝”,隨後啟用它。啟用後,系統會自動啟動設定嚮導,引導你完成商店基本資訊的配置,包括地址、貨幣、支付和物流型別等。此階段無需過度糾結於細節,大部分設定後續均可調整。

接下來,選擇一個與WooCommerce深度相容的主題至關重要。你可以從官方庫中選擇免費主題,或購買功能更強大的高階主題。安裝並激活主題後,建議透過“外觀” -> “自定義”選單進行初步的樣式調整。同時,為了保障網站安全並提升SEO表現,應立即安裝並配置如Wordfence Security以及Yoast SEO或者Rank Math這類必備外掛。基礎準備完成後,你的網站就具備了新增產品和處理交易的能力。

推荐阅读 WooCommerce设置分步指南:如何从零开始搭建你的在线商店

產品管理與商店配置

商店的核心是產品。WooCommerce提供了強大而靈活的產品管理系統。要新增新產品,請導航至“產品” -> “新增新產品”。這裡你需要填寫產品標題、詳細描述,並設定關鍵資料,如價格、庫存狀態(啟用庫存管理需勾選“管理庫存?”)、SKU以及產品圖片庫。

UltaHost WordPress 主機
30天退款保證,無限頻寬與資料庫,免費的 DDoS 防護,購買3年優惠50%

產品型別與屬性的運用

WooCommerce支援多種產品型別,包括簡單產品、可變產品、分組產品和外部/關聯產品。對於同一產品具有不同屬性(如尺寸、顏色)的情況,應使用“可變產品”。在“產品資料”面板中,選擇“可變產品”,然後在“屬性”選項卡中新增屬性,如“顏色”,並輸入值“紅色,藍色”。接著,在“變體”選項卡中,點選“從所有屬性建立變體”,系統便會為你生成紅色和藍色兩個獨立的子產品,你可以為每個變體單獨設定價格、庫存和圖片。

稅費與配送設定

正確的稅費和配送設定對於合規經營至關重要。在“WooCommerce” -> “設定” -> “常規”中,設定好你的營業地址。然後,在“稅費”選項卡中,根據你的業務區域啟用稅費計算,並新增相應的稅率。例如,可以設定一個針對歐盟的標準稅率。
配送設定位於“WooCommerce” -> “設定” -> “配送”中。你需要先建立“配送區域”,例如“中國境內”。在該區域內,點選“新增配送方式”,可以選擇“免費配送”、“ flat rate(統一費率)”或“本地自提”等。例如,為“統一費率”設定一個固定費用或基於購物車總計的公式。

支付閘道器整合與訂單處理

支付是電商流程的閉環。WooCommerce內建了多種支付閘道器。配置入口在“WooCommerce” -> “設定” -> “支付”中。你可以看到如“Stripe”、“PayPal”、“銀行轉賬”等選項。

主流支付方式配置

以配置信用卡收款為例,你可以選擇Stripe或者PayPal Payments外掛。啟用Stripe後,你需要輸入釋出金鑰和金鑰金鑰,這些資訊需要從你的Stripe賬戶獲取。啟用“測試模式”可以在網站上線前用測試卡號進行交易模擬,確保一切無誤。
對於PayPal,標準的PayPal Standard或更現代的PayPal Payments外掛都是可靠選擇。配置時需要你的PayPal商家郵箱或客戶端ID和金鑰。

推荐阅读 WooCommerce 商城終極指南:從零到上線的完整建站教程

訂單管理與客戶溝通

當顧客完成下單,訂單會自動出現在“WooCommerce” -> “訂單”列表中。在這裡,你可以檢視每一筆訂單的詳細資訊,包括顧客資訊、購買商品、金額和支付狀態。訂單狀態會從“等待付款”變為“處理中”、“已完成”等。
你可以手動更新訂單狀態,並新增訂單備註。這些備註可以選擇是否透過電子郵件通知客戶,這是與客戶溝通訂單進度的重要渠道。例如,當訂單發貨後,你可以將狀態更新為“已完成”,並新增備註“包裹已發出,運單號為:XX”,並勾選“通知客戶”,客戶便會收到一封包含該資訊的郵件。

效能最佳化與上線前檢查

在網站對外開放前,進行全面的最佳化和檢查至關重要,這直接影響使用者體驗和搜尋引擎排名。

速度和快取最佳化

WooCommerce是動態網站,頁面載入速度是關鍵。首要措施是配置快取。推薦使用如WP RocketW3 Total Cache或者LiteSpeed Cache等快取外掛。同時,務必啟用“永久連結”(固定連結),在“設定” -> “固定連結”中選擇“文章名”或“自定義結構”,這有助於生成清晰、對SEO友好的URL。
圖片最佳化也是重中之重。在上傳產品圖前,應使用工具壓縮圖片尺寸。同時,可以安裝如Smush或者ShortPixel外掛進行自動壓縮和WebP格式轉換。以下是一個簡單的functions.php程式碼片段,用於限制產品列表每頁顯示的商品數量,這也有助於提升列表頁載入速度:

hostng.com 共享主机
高效能,配备 AMD EPYC CPU、NVMe SSD 存储和 LiteSpeed,全天候 24 小时专业内部支持,先进的安全措施包括 SSL、暴力破解、恶意软件和 DDoS 防护,节省高达 731 TB/月的带宽成本。
add_filter( 'loop_shop_per_page', 'custom_products_per_page', 20 );
function custom_products_per_page( $cols ) {
    // 将每页显示商品数量改为 12 个
    return 12;
}

安全與功能測試清單

上線前必須進行全流程測試。建立一個測試訂單,使用支付閘道器的沙盒模式完成從選購、加入購物車、填寫地址、選擇配送方式、支付到生成訂單的完整流程。確保郵件通知系統工作正常,包括新訂單通知給管理員、訂單狀態更新郵件給客戶等。這可以透過安裝如WP Mail SMTP外掛並配置一個可靠的SMTP服務來大幅提升郵件送達率。
最後,在“設定” -> “閱讀”中,取消勾選“對搜尋引擎的可見性”,以確保你的網站可以被Google和Bing等搜尋引擎索引。使用工具如Google PageSpeed Insights對你的關鍵頁面進行速度測試,並根據建議進行改進。

总结

從零開始構建一個WooCommerce電商網站是一個系統性的工程,涵蓋了環境準備、核心安裝、產品配置、支付整合以及最終的最佳化上線。每個環節都緊密相連,產品的靈活管理是商店的基石,穩定安全的支付流程是商業閉環的保障,而效能最佳化則是提升使用者體驗和轉換率的關鍵。遵循本文的步驟指南,開發者可以清晰地規劃專案路徑,避免常見陷阱,最終打造出一個既專業又高效的線上商店。記住,網站上線並非終點,持續的內容更新、資料分析和功能迭代才是長期成功的開始。

常见问题解答(FAQ)

### WooCommerce是免費的嗎?
WooCommerce外掛本身是完全免費和開源的。你可以免費下載、安裝和使用其所有核心電商功能,包括產品管理、購物車、結賬和訂單處理。

推荐阅读 深入解析 WooCommerce 开源电商框架:从搭建到高级定制的全攻略

但是,為了構建一個功能完整、外觀專業的商店,你可能需要購買付費的擴充套件外掛(用於特定支付閘道器、物流整合、會員制等)、高階主題,以及承擔域名和主機的費用。

如何更改結賬頁面的欄位順序或刪除不需要的欄位?

你可以透過程式碼片段或使用專門的外掛來定製結賬欄位。推薦使用Checkout Field Editor for WooCommerce這類外掛,它提供了直觀的介面讓你可以新增、刪除、編輯欄位及其順序。

InterServer 共享主机
虚拟主机的月费为1TB+5TB,价格为2.50美元。首月优惠价为1TB+5TB,价格为0.1美元。优惠码为"tryinterserver"。平台提供461个云应用脚本,一键安装便捷。

如果希望透過程式碼實現,可以在主題的functions.php檔案中使用WooCommerce提供的過濾器鉤子,例如woocommerce_checkout_fields。例如,要移除“公司名字”欄位,可以使用如下程式碼:

add_filter( ‘woocommerce_checkout_fields‘, ‘custom_override_checkout_fields’ );
function custom_override_checkout_fields( $fields ) {
    unset($fields[‘billing’][‘billing_company’]); // 移除账单公司字段
    return $fields;
}

網站上線後如何增加商品?

上線後增加商品的過程與開發階段完全一致。只需登入WordPress後臺,導航至“產品” -> “新增新產品”,然後填寫產品資訊、設定價格和庫存、上傳圖片併發布即可。

你還可以批次匯入產品。透過“產品” -> “匯入”功能,下載CSV模板檔案,按照格式填寫好產品資料後,再上傳該CSV檔案即可批次匯入大量商品,非常適合從其他平臺遷移或一次性上架大量庫存。

怎样备份我的 WooCommerce 网站?

定期備份是網站運營的救命稻草。最可靠的方式是使用專業的WordPress備份外掛,例如UpdraftPlusBackupBuddy或者BlogVault。這些外掛可以讓你輕鬆設定自動備份計劃,將完整的網站檔案和資料(包括產品、訂單)備份到雲端儲存(如Google Drive、Dropbox)。

切勿僅依賴主機商提供的備份,建議自己掌握一份獨立的、最近的備份副本。在進行任何重大更新(如主題、外掛或WordPress核心更新)之前,手動建立一次完整備份是一個最佳實踐。